How do human wingspans compare to albatross wingspans

Human wingspans are much smaller than those of albatross. That is, the ration of wingspan to height for humans is around 1.0, whereas for albatross it is closer to 3.0. ... Albatross fly thousands of miles each year. They use their long wings to soar on wind currents over the ocean.
